공상하는 개발자

[안드로이드/android] sns 친구맺기 데이터 스트럭쳐 본문

개발/안드로이드

[안드로이드/android] sns 친구맺기 데이터 스트럭쳐

공상과학소설 2019. 7. 22. 11:49
반응형

user 테이블

1
2
3
4
5
6
7
create table user(
id varchar(20),
password varchar(20not null default null,
nickname varchar(10not null unique,
sex char(1not null default 'm',
Api_Token varchar(20default 'ERYON',
primary key(id,Api_Token));

 

 

relationship 테이블

1
2
3
4
5
6
7
create table relationship(
one_name varchar(10),
two_name varchar(10),
status enum('0','1','2'default '0',    //    0: 대기중인 친구요청   1: 수락   2: 거부(차단)
primary key(one_name,two_name),
constraint fk_name1 foreign key(one_name) references user(nickname) on delete cascade,
constraint fk_name2 foreign key(two_name) references user(nickname) on delete cascade);

 

반응형
Comments